Repeal Preemption Legislation on Smoking

RESOLVED: That, if comprehensive statewide legislation to ban smoking in all worksites including bars and restaurants is not enacted, MSMS aggressively pursue legislation to repeal the preemption legislation that does not allow counties and cities to have more restrictive smoking legislation than the state has approved; and be it furtherRESOLVED: That MSMS encourage every county medical society to pass a similar resolution internally to call for a repeal of the preemption legislation that does not allow counties and cities to have more restrictive smoking legislation than the state has approved and seek support of other organizations with whom they interact to do the same to create a massive ground-swell of support.
